Talk Radio (Harper Style)

We got this little radio station here in Harper. The studio is located in the Harper Lake Motel and you can drop by any time and watch the announcer or DJ as they perform their duties. The station manager is a second or third cousin of mine and is real creative. He has had shows that gave away trips to the Gulf Coast, free meals at local cafes, and occasionally a radio or TV. The sponsors foot the bill and use it for advertising purposes. One of my favorite shows is call Swap Column of the Air. People call in with things they want to swap or even sell. I had a friend down from Missouri and we were riding around Harper Lake. I was showing him the sights. He started fiddling with the car radio and came up on the Swap Column show. People were trying to sell or swap such things as washing machines, TV sets, and even cars. One fellow called in and wanted to sell some puppies. Seems his dog had a litter of eight and he was asking ten dollars a pup. He said they were pure bred beagles. The way the show works is to allow the seller and the sellee to discuss the transaction on the air. One caller inquired, "Do these dogs have papers?" "No need," replied the seller. "They is all completely house broke." My friend thought this was funnier than I did.
